While Apple IS producing what seem to be qualitatively superior products now compared with their missteps of the past few years, their documentation of how they do and don¡¯t work is frustratingly poor (as is the knowledge of the people who are deployed to support them, either by phone or on site).

Witness the way in which the boot volume is actually TWO volumes but cloaked as one. Why is that preferable to just making it clear that there¡¯s a read-only system volume and a separate volume containing user accounts, productivity apps, and user-changeable settings.
